Virginia Beach, 01.31.24 | Nacha, a leading authority in the payment industry, hosted an enlightening webinar on December 13, 2023, titled “Closing in on Fraud: How to Protect Your Financial Transactions.” The event brought together thought leaders to delve into strategies and insights to fortify financial transactions, particularly emphasizing the real estate sector.

The webinar addressed the vulnerability of significant financial transactions in real
estate deals where substantial sums change hands. Nacha’s mission was to empower participants with the knowledge and tools necessary to safeguard their financial endeavors.

Key takeaways from the webinar included:
Common Payment Fraud Trends: Participants gained awareness of prevalent fraud trends, equipping them with the knowledge to recognize and combat emerging threats.
Tips for Prevention: The webinar shared practical tips for preventing fraudsters from infiltrating systems, offering proactive measures to fortify financial processes.
Robust Solutions Implementation: Industry experts explored the implementation of robust solutions to reduce fraud losses, emphasizing the importance of a comprehensive approach.


The webinar featured distinguished speakers who brought diverse perspectives to the
discussion:
Jordan Bennett (Nacha): Jordan set the stage by shedding light on the exponential growth of ACH credit push fraud, underlining its impact across various industries.
Jim Weld (Rynoh): Rynoh provided a concise overview of their business, delving into the nuanced landscape of risk and fraud growth. Weld shared real world examples, honing in on wire and ACH fraud tactics, showcasing the need for proactive measures.
Lawrence Pannell (Early Warning): Lawrence detailed Early Warning’s proactive approach to fraud prevention, specifically addressing the intricacies of wire fraud and account validation. He demonstrated how these solutions are versatile and applicable across diverse industries.
